ED Issues Notice To 3 Engineers For MGNREGA Fund Embezzlement In Odisha’s Mayurbhanj

Bhubaneswar: The Enforcement Directorate (ED has issued notice to 3 engineers in connection with irregularities in MGNREGA works worth over Rs 3 crore in Odisha’s Mayurbhanj district.

According to sources, the government had sanctioned Rs 3.21 crore for various development works under MGNREGA in Podagada, Barehipani, Astakumar, Gurugadia and Dhalabani panchayats under Jashipur block in 2019-20 financial year.

Following allegation that a large amount of the fund was embezzled without executing the works, then Jashipur BDO Anupama Ghosh informed the district administration and started investigation.

On the basis of investigation report, the BDO had filed complaints against 25 persons in Jashipur police station.  The police had arrested 3 sarpanches and a PEO in this connection.

During questioning of the arrested persons, the entire scam came to light. The administration removed sarpanches of all five panchayats and the PEO. Besides, an assistant engineer, 2 junior engineers and another official were suspended for their alleged involvement in the irregularities.

Later, the case was handed over to Vigilance department. But the officials went absconding. However, on the basis of the revelations made by the sarpanches, the case was taken up by the ED.

After the suspended officials rejoined their jobs, the ED issued the notices to them. They included then assistant engineer Rajendra Kumar Patra, junior engineers Dibyalochan Nayak and Samir Kabi. The engineers have been told to appear before the ED on March 20.
